Deno
Deno is a runtime environment for JavaScript and TypeScript as it provides a secure and efficient way to execute the code. In Node.js there was some security issues due to its dependence nature that rely on a single-threaded event loop so overcoming its problem, Deno was designed which is more specific and target its simplicity and security for the applications.
It restricts the code’s access to the system and network by default as this is a security feature that prevents if from malicious code that can access sensitive information or can causing harm to the system as well. It provides a more secure and efficient environment for executing code.
Features:
- The scripts can’t access your file system, network, or environment this gives you a control over what a script can and can’t do on your computer or server.
- Deno offers a collection of dependency, and standard modules.
- Deno comes with a set of built-in utilities, such as a test runner, and a code formatter that reduces the need for third-party tools.
Limitations:
- In deno fewer libraries, tools, and community resources are available.
- Deno doesn’t support Node.js modules out of the box.
- Developers must need to find alternatives to make existing Node.js projects run in Deno.
- Deno isn’t as widely adopted in the industry as Node.js.
Top 10 Spring Boot Alternatives [2024 Updated]
Spring Boot is a popular Java framework for building web applications, it makes development easier for developers with such ready-to-use templates and tools. There are various other tools as well that can act as an alternative to Spring Boot. Do you want to know about such tools which act as an alternative to SpringBoot?
In this blog, we’ll be talking about the Top 10 Spring Boot Alternative in 2024. There are many other tools available out there that can lead us to the same for both frontend and backend tasks. If you’re willing to explore some other options for development, check out these 10 different frameworks.
Join our “JAVA Backend Development – Live” course to dive into the world of backend development with Java. Learn how to build robust and scalable server-side applications using Java, and enhance your skills in backend programming.
Contact Us